Applause IT are recruiting for a Programme Manager / PMO Lead to join a specialist technology organisation delivering secure projects and programmes within defence, cyber security and government environments.
This is a senior delivery-focused position responsible for leading a portfolio of complex customer projects across highly secure technical environments. The successful candidate will play a key role in project governance, stakeholder management, delivery assurance and PMO leadership whilst working closely with engineering teams, customers and senior leadership.
The role would suit an experienced Programme Manager or PMO Lead with a strong background delivering projects into MOD, defence, government or security-cleared environments.
Candidates should be comfortable operating across both Agile and Waterfall delivery models and have experience managing project risk, commercial considerations, customer relationships and delivery governance within complex technical programmes.
